What Is Aluminum Chloride and How Antiperspirants Work
Aluminum chloride is a metallic salt that reduces sweating by temporarily blocking sweat ducts. In antiperspirant products, it forms a gel-like plug within the duct, lowering underarm moisture without affecting systemic physiology. Prescription versions use higher concentrations for clinical hyperhidrosis; over-the-counter (OTC) options use lower strengths for everyday protection. This mechanism is distinct from deodorants, which only address odor and not wetness.
Efficacy and Onset of Action
Products containing aluminum chloride are among the most effective non-prescription options for managing underarm sweating. Clinical studies report significant reductions in sweat loss, often within the first few applications when used nightly. Full benefit typically appears after one to two weeks of consistent use. Effectiveness depends on correct application technique and product formulation strength.
Application Routine for Best Results
- Apply to completely dry skin at bedtime.
- Use a thin, even layer; less is often more.
- Allow time to dry before dressing.
- Expect reduced sweating after several nightly applications.
Safety, Side Effects, and Precautions
Topical aluminum chloride is generally safe when used as directed. Common, mostly mild side effects include skin irritation, redness, and itching. Formulations may include emollients or pH adjusters to minimize discomfort. If irritation occurs, reduce frequency, use moisturizers, or consult a clinician before stopping use. There is no verified evidence linking topical aluminum chloride in antiperspirants to systemic health risks at typical doses.
Product Types and Concentration Ranges
Over-the-counter antiperspirants with aluminum chloride commonly range from 10% to 20% active ingredient, often combined with alcohol for rapid drying. Clinical or prescription variants can reach higher concentrations and may use different carriers to optimize comfort and adherence. Selecting the right product depends on sweat severity, skin sensitivity, and lifestyle factors.
| Attribute | Verified Detail | Source Type |
|---|---|---|
| Active Ingredient | Aluminum chloride (often 10–20% in OTC) | Label and clinical summaries |
| Typical Onset of Visible Effect | Several days to 2 weeks with nightly use | Clinical guidelines |
| Common Side Effects | Local skin irritation, redness, itching | Dermatology literature |
| Usage Frequency | Nightly initially, then as needed for maintenance | Dermatology practice patterns |
| Systemic Absorption | Minimal with topical use; not a concern at recommended doses | Toxicology assessments |
Choosing the Best Antiperspirant with Aluminum Chloride
The best antiperspirant in this category balances effectiveness, formulation tolerability, and fit with daily routine. Look for a thin, non-sticky formula that dries quickly, minimizes fragrance if you have sensitivities, and clearly states aluminum chloride concentration. Consider whether you need a clinical or cosmetic finish, and whether you prefer roll-on, pump, or stick formats. For sensitive skin, patch testing and adjunctive use of a moisturizer can improve adherence.
Practical Tips and Maintenance
Use antiperspirant at night for optimal duct blocking; reapply in the morning only if needed. Shave carefully and allow skin to recover before application to reduce irritation. Launder shirts promptly to prevent residue buildup; rotate products if tolerance changes. If sweating suddenly worsens or new symptoms appear, consult a healthcare professional to rule out secondary causes.
